About Us
Amateur theatre has been performing at the Sandgate Town Hall since the 1958.
At the time they started with a donation of £5,5s from the local Rotary group under the name
The Sandgate Little Theatre Group.
Currently operating under the name of
Sandgate Theatre Inc., our theatre group performs three major plays (2 or 3 act) plays a year, as well as:
- The Theatre Restaurant - a musical play presented with a scrumptious three course meal,
- The One Acts - a collection of one-act plays and skits put together in one performance, and
- The Yarrageh Drama Festival, with amateur theatre groups from throughout South-East Queensland presenting their best one-act plays here at Sandgate.
Our plays range from hilarious comedies to serious dramas.
